Summary

A new deep learning model, DualWKNet, combined with surface-enhanced Raman spectroscopy (SERS), enables rapid, separation-free bacterial detection. This breakthrough improves food safety and disease diagnosis by accurately identifying bacteria like E. coli without complex sample preparation.
